Trip Report: Mountaineering - Golden Ears

Adventure is just 1 thought away. Our thought: hike 24 kilometers, ascend 5000 feet...to summit one of the coolest summits on the northern skyline: Golden Ears covered in spring mountaineering conditions.

It took us 12 hours of constant effort with my buddy Dave...but we got-er-done. It was an amazing day. Check out the pics and slide show:
